Definition

  1. 1
    Scorpius.
  2. 2
    The zodiac sign for the scorpion, ruled by Mars and covering October 23 - November 22 (tropical astrology) or November 16 - December 15 (sidereal astrology).

Etymology

From Latin scorpiō (“scorpion”), from Ancient Greek σκορπίος (skorpíos), calque of Akkadian 𒀯𒄈𒋰 (zuqaqīpu, “scorpion; constellation name”), calque of Sumerian 𒀯𒄈𒋰 (ᴹᵁᴸGIR₂.TAB). Doublet of scorpion.
